How Verification Works: The Requirements

Verification is not optional. It's the law for UK-licensed casinos. Duffspin demanded my documents almost right after I filed the withdrawal request. This "Know Your Customer" or KYC check is required by the UK Gambling Commission to fight fraud. The request came by email, and the instructions were clear.

They required three things from me: proof of who I am, proof of where I live, and proof of the payment method I used. I sent everything through a secure portal in my casino account. It's an extra step, but a proper verification process is actually a mark of a trustworthy operator. It's there to protect everyone.

Documents Sent for KYC

For proof of identity, I sent a clear picture of my valid UK driving licence. A recent gas bill, less than three months old, was used for my proof of address. To prove my payment method, I uploaded a screenshot of my Skrill account history showing the deposit to Duffspin. I ensured to blur out any sensitive info first.

The upload portal was simple. It accepted standard files like JPEGs and PDFs. Each document displayed a little status icon once it was uploaded. The key is to make sure everything is easy to read and that the name and address match your casino account details perfectly. A small mismatch, like a missing middle initial, can hold everything up.

Common Challenges and Ways to Prevent Them

A few common problems can hold up your cashout. The primary culprit is the document checks. Be completely sure the registered info on your casino account are identical to your official documents. Leaving out a middle name or having a slight spelling difference can get your documents rejected. Provide full, clear copies of what is required.

The other major tripwire is wagering conditions. Make sure to review your bonus balance and playthrough status before attempting a cashout. If you request a payout before fulfilling the conditions, the site will reject the payout and you might forfeit the bonus. Be honest with yourself about the conditions you signed up for.
